A wonderful day
Marlon our driver and guide was excellent. His knowledge of the Island was excellent. We had a brilliant time at the YS falls. It was a small part of paradise. Our guide took some wonderful photos and my son loved the rope swing at the top of the waterfall. Marlon didn’t rush us at any part of the trip. We stopped at a local restaurant with lovely food before heading off to the Floyd pelican bar. We were taken via a fisherman’s boat to the bar in the middle of the sea. This was not to our taste but that’s our personal preference as others may like it. (Teenagers will get bored quickly with no way to return earlier). Marlon was so lovely that we have booked another trip with him today to Rick’s Cafe.

Fab day
Marlon is an amazing guide. YS Falls did not disappoint, amazing experience. Swim shoes definitely needed, still slippy so care needed but guide that takes you around is very helpful & takes loads of photos for you. Pelican Bar is a definite must visit surreal feeling, a var in the middle of the Caribbean. All round a fabulous say
